Tickets

Llanrhaeadr Ym Mochnant Gardens

Market Street, Llanrhaeadr Ym Mochnant, Oswestry, Shropshire, SY10 0JN

Date: Saturday 17th May

12pm - 5pm

£6.00

£0.00